    Description: The Crepidorhopalon whytei (Linderniaceae) species complex is revised using morphological analyses. Based primarily on variations in indumentum, floral morphology, corolla colour and seed morphology, four species are formally recognised within this group in eastern Africa. Crepidorhopalon whytei s.str. is widespread in the highlands of eastern Africa, extending from South Sudan and Ethiopia in the north through to western Tanzania in the south. A new combination in Crepidorhopalon is made for Lindernia flava (= C. flavus), which is confined to the Manica Highlands of the Mozambique-Zimbabwe border. Two new species are described, C. namuliensis which is known only from Mt Namuli in northern Mozambique and C. kwaleensis which is known only from the coastal lowlands of southeast Kenya. A fifth, imperfectly known species is documented from the Nguru Mountains of Tanzania where it is so far known from a single collection. Three names are lectotypified. The habitat requirements and distribution are documented and the extinction risk is assessed for each species. Crepidorhopalon flavus is assessed as globally Vulnerable and C. kwaleensis as globally Endangered, while C. namuliensis and C. whytei are currently considered to be of Least Concern, although the latter is declining markedly in parts of its range. The botanical importance of the key sites for the newly recognised taxa is discussed.

    Description: The dataset comprises a total of 7,134 records of presence and absence for 87 sea star taxa (84 % on species level, 16 % others) from 72 trawl samples (Agassiz trawl, bottom trawl, Rauschert dredge, epibenthic sledge) and 10 others (multi-box corer, giant box corer, amphipod trap, fish trap, CTD logger). The dataset was collected in the Antarctic Weddell Sea and western Antarctic Peninsula (depth range: 94 - 1353 m) during “Polarstern” cruises ANT I/2 (1983), ANT II/4 (1983/84), ANT V/3 (1987), ANT VI/3 (1987/88), ANT XV/3 (1998) and ANT XVII/3 (2000).

    Description: This data set contains carbonate dissolution indices as well as calcium carbonate content values measured on surface sediment samples from the Norwegian-Greenland Sea, which were investigated to reconstruct the spatial distribution of recent carbonate dissolution on the sea-floor.

    Description: The dataset comprises a total of 540 records of abundance of Astrotoma agassizii Lyman, 1875, Ophionotus victoriae (Bell, 1902), Ophioplinthus brevirima (Mortensen, 1936), Ophioplinthus gelida (Koehler, 1901) and Ophioplocus incipiens (Koehler, 1922) from 106 trawl samples (Agassiz trawl, bottom trawl, dredge) and two others (multi-box corer, weir basket). The dataset was collected on the shelf and slope of the Antarctic Weddell Sea and Lazarev Sea (depth range: 130 - 970 m) during "Polarstern" cruises ANT I/2 (1983), ANT II/4 (1983/84), ANT V/3 and 4 (1986/87), ANT VI/3 (1987/88), ANT IX/3 (1990/91) and ANT X/3 (1992).

    Description: The dataset comprises a total of 336 records of abundance and biomass of two sea urchin species, Sterechinus antarcticus Koehler, 1901 and Sterechinus neumayeri (Meissner, 1900), from 67 trawls (Agassiz trawl, bottom trawl or dredge), 56 photo sessions (see doi link to photographs in dataset) and three other samples (multi-box corer, giant box corer, weir basket). The data were collected on the eastern and southern shelf and slope of the Antarctic Weddell Sea (depth range: 97 - 1243 m) during "Polarstern" cruises ANT I/2 (1983), ANT II/4 (1984), ANT III/3 (1985), ANT V/3 (1986), ANT V/4 (1987), ANT VI/3 (1988) and ANT VII/4 (1989).

    Description: Heat transfer velocities measured during three different campaigns in the Baltic Sea using the Active Controlled Flux Technique (ACFT) with wind speeds ranging from 5.3 to 14.8 m s−1 are presented. Careful scaling of the heat transfer velocities to gas transfer velocities using Schmidt number exponents measured in a laboratory study allows to compare the measured transfer velocities to existing gas transfer velocity parameterizations, which use wind speed as the controlling parameter. The measured data and other field data clearly show that some gas transfer velocities are much lower than the empirical wind speed parametrizations. This indicates that the dependencies of the transfer velocity on the fetch, i.e., the history of the wind and the age of the wind wave field, and the effects of surface active material need to be taken into account. Data set contains: Measured heat transfer velocities kheat in dependency of time, position, wind speed and water and air temperature for the measurements on RV Alkor and RV Aranda in 2009 and 2010. Furthermore the Prandtl number Pr, the Schmidt number exponent n and the scaled transfer velocity k600 are given. The given times are approximate starting times in UTC. Each measurements lasted about 20 min.

    Description: The data set comprises a total of 3,240 records of abundance of 24 polychaete taxa of the families Aphroditides and Polynoids (88 % of the taxa were identified at species or subspecies level). The data were collected in the Southern Ocean, i.e. the Weddell Sea, the Lazarev Sea and the plateau region of South Orkney (depth range: 126 - 2025 m). A total of 135 trawls (Agassiz trawl, bottom trawl, dredge, benthopelagic trawl) were used during RV "Polarstern" cruises ANT I/2 (1983), ANT II/4 (1983/84), ANT V/3 and 4 (1986/87), ANT VII/4 (1989), ANT IX/3 (1990/91) and ANT X/3 (1992).

    Description: Bathymetry data based on multibeam echosounder EM120 was conducted during R/V SONNE cruise SO222 between 09.06.2012 and 30.06.2012 (Leg A) and 04.07.2012 and 18.07.2012 (Leg B) in the Nankai Trough off Japan. The main objective of the cruise was MeBo drilling and long-term monitoring of active mud volcanoes in the northern Kumano Basin, which carry gas hydrates and are overlying an area of high strain. Hydroacoustic work on board aimed at a high spatial coverage of the Kumano Basin and its mud volcanoes. Furthermore, bathymetric mapping revealed additional features in the study area, of which 5 previously unknown mud volcanoes were identified. Additionally, coring with gravity corers and the MeBO drill rig as well as the deployment of CORK observation instruments and an ROV helped to study the activity and products of mud volcanoes in the Kumano Basin. CI Citation: Paul Wintersteller (seafloor-imaging@marum.de) as responsible party for bathymetry raw data ingest and approval. Description of the data source: During the SO222 cruise, the hull-mounted KONGSBERG EM120 multibeam ecosounder (MBES) was utilized for bathymetric mapping as it is able to perform in water depths up to 11,000 m. Two transducer arrays transmit acoustic signals of 11.25 to 12.6 kHz in successive emission-reception cycles. 191 overlapping beams in a 2° (TX) by 2° (RX) footprint form each acoustic ping, resulting in a beam width of maximum 150° across track and 2° along track. For further information on the system, consult https://www.km.kongsberg.com/. The depth of the water column is estimated through the two-way-travel time, beam angle and ray bending due to refraction in the water column by sound speed variations. Combining lateral and center beams secures measurement accuracy practically independent of the beam-pointing angle. During the cruise SO222, the MBES and PARASOUND sub-bottom profiler were continuously acquiring data of about 1500 km track lengths. Two sound velocity profiles (SVP) were calculated based on SEABIRD CTD measurements and applied to the MBES, whereas no SVP was available for the southern Kumano Basin due to strong currents.
